Looking for a way to connect with nature and take a break from the
hustle of daily life? The Dahlem Center just outside of Jackson at 7117 South Jackson Road, is an incredible natural environment of nearly 300 acres. The Dahlem Center provides educational classes, summer camps, and a little something for people of all ages and abilities to enjoy. Dahlem showcases 5 miles of natural hiking trails and a
nearly ½ mile accessible “Nature for All Trail” made of crushed limestone. The Nature for All Trail takes people on a loop from the main entrance out through the woods and back to the main office building. The trails are free to use and are open dawn to dusk year-round (including holidays).
My favorite part, aside from having an accessible trail, is the newest additions to the “Nature for All Trail” installed at the beginning of 2021. New stations (developed in collaboration with Henry Ford Allegiance Health) posted along the trail (as shown in the photo below) demonstrate how to do some simple stretches or movements such as yoga poses, jumping jacks, plus arm/leg stretches. Four spinning infographics are also posted along the accessible
trail. The infographics provide images and descriptions of what you can see as you look around the trail as you go. The whole of nature is beautiful, and now you know what you are looking at.
